📝 Walkthrough

Walkthrough

Release v2.0.0: introduces SafeTextFilter and PhoneNumberChecker backed by an Aho‑Corasick engine, removes the bundled asset/bad_words.txt, adds 40+ language data files, and rewrites README/CHANGELOG and workspace settings.

🧹 Nitpick comments (2)
assets/data/hr.txt (1)

1-243: Consider establishing data governance practices for language assets.

With 75+ language data files being introduced, establishing clear processes will help maintain quality and consistency:

  1. Data provenance: Document the sources and methodology for each language dataset
  2. Update cadence: Define how frequently these files should be reviewed and updated
  3. Quality assurance: Consider implementing validation scripts to check for encoding issues, duplicates, or formatting inconsistencies across all data files
  4. Cultural review: Given the sensitive nature of profanity filtering, consider involving native speakers or cultural consultants for accuracy
  5. Versioning: Track changes to individual language files to understand the evolution of datasets

README.md (1)

97-101: Minor technical imprecision in performance explanation

The explanation states: "With 10,000+ words, this grew exponentially slow."

More precisely, a nested loop approach grows linearly with the number of patterns (O(N × P)), not exponentially (O(2^N)). The performance difference vs. Aho-Corasick is still dramatic but describing it as linear growth would be more technically accurate.

📚 Suggested refinement for technical accuracy
-Legacy versions used a nested loop approach (for every bad word, run a regex). With 10,000+ words, this grew exponentially slow. 
+Legacy versions used a nested loop approach (for every bad word, run a regex). With 10,000+ words, performance degraded linearly with pattern count (O(N × P)).
